Google Finance

I always thought it was funny that when you searched for a ticker on Google that the results linked to Yahoo finance and I figured it wouldn’t last long - apparently they released Google finance this morning.

Having played with it for a few minutes the thing that I like the most about it is that when you change the date range on the chart the page doesn’t need to be refreshed - I’m not sure what the technology is here (ajax?) but so far I like it a lot better than MSN money or Yahoo finance.
